Output d63866acf83f7be296106b9bc0cff952ce8d752ce8ccd7d4445ede8f640966c0:21

value
90000
script pubkey
OP_0 OP_PUSHBYTES_20 32c3ad93db4b00e7c55d399635bc164edbc65c45
address
bc1qxtp6my7mfvqw032a8xtrt0qkfmduvhz9wag4se
transaction
d63866acf83f7be296106b9bc0cff952ce8d752ce8ccd7d4445ede8f640966c0
confirmations
227515
spent
true